said by Forlin :Even if his LCD is 60hz vsync will still only cap at 60 FPS. That's what it does, match the frame rate to the frequency to avoid tearing. exactly. But if the computer cannot produce the 60 fps, because of vsync it will only display full complete frames. Because of that, it will display only 30fps because it doesn't have a new frame ready to feed the monitor every cycle, so you get the same frame twice if it is putting out between 30 and 59fps. |
